>> The proposal introduces a new tag car=* that applies to just cars, and 
>> clarifies the meaning of the motorcar=* tag, which applies access=* 
>> restrictions to cars and larger vehicles like trucks, busses, etc.
> 
> 
> You state: "No specific legal definition is given since country
> specific or even local law does differ too widely with respect to
> vehicle classes." but how can you then determine if your car with an
> 1-axle-trailer is included or not? Or your car with a length of 6,5 ?
> Or your car which only has 2 seats and legally goes as "goods"-vehicle
> even if it is a small car?

As a driver, it is your legal obligation to be familiar with local laws and 
regulations.

I'm rather certain that most mappers are incapable of properly (in the legal 
sense) defining access restrictions, so the data that we add to the map must 
rely on common sense and indications that are easily verifiable, such as 
traffic signs.  (I encourage you to research parking restrictions in Germany 
for sign 1048-10, and to which vehicles they apply or don't apply.  You'll find 
that there's significantly diverging opinions.  OSM isn't the place to try and 
settle these.)
